Sourcing guidance for T Motor

What are the key technical specifications to evaluate when sourcing T-Motors for industrial drones?

When selecting T-Motors, you must prioritize KV ratings, Maximum Thrust, and Efficiency (g/W). For heavy-lift industrial drones, look for motors with low KV (e.g., 100-170KV) to drive large propellers efficiently. Ensure the motor supports the required Voltage (Lipo cells, typically 6S-12S) and check the Internal Resistance; lower resistance indicates better efficiency and less heat generation. Always verify the IP Rating (e.g., IP55) if the drone will operate in dusty or rainy environments.

How do I ensure the authenticity and quality of T-Motor products in a B2B transaction?

T-Motor is a premium brand, so you must verify the Anti-counterfeit code provided on the packaging. Request factory inspection reports and QC certificates from the supplier. For high-end series like the U-Series (U8, U10, U15), ensure the supplier provides dynamometer test data to confirm the thrust-to-power ratio matches the official datasheet. What compliance standards are necessary for importing T-Motors into international markets?

Motors must comply with CE (EMC and LVD directives) for the European market and FCC for the US if they are part of an integrated electronic system. Since these are high-performance brushless motors, ensure they meet RoHS (Restriction of Hazardous Substances) standards. If the motors are intended for military or dual-use applications, you must check for Export Control Classification Numbers (ECCN) to avoid legal complications during customs clearance.

What are the usage scenarios and compatibility requirements for T-Motor propulsion systems?

T-Motors are widely used in Agricultural Spraying, Aerial Mapping, and Cinematography. Compatibility is key: ensure the motor's mounting hole pattern (e.g., 30x30mm or 40x40mm) matches your drone frame. Furthermore, the motor must be paired with a compatible Electronic Speed Controller (ESC)—ideally T-Motor’s own Flame or Alpha series—to ensure optimal FOC (Field Oriented Control) performance and communication protocols like CAN bus or PWM.

What is the best shipping strategy for high-value electronic components like brushless motors?

Due to the strong magnets inside T-Motors, they are classified as Magnetic Goods for air freight. You must ensure the supplier uses magnetic shielding packaging and provides a Magnetic Inspection Report to avoid delays or rejection by airlines. For large volumes, Sea Freight (LCL/FCL) is more economical, but ensure the packaging includes desiccant packs to prevent corrosion during long transit times.

How should I negotiate lead times and MOQs for customized T-Motor orders?

Standard T-Motors usually have an MOQ of 4-10 units, but customized shafts or windings may require 50+ units. Negotiate a staggered delivery schedule for large annual contracts to maintain lean inventory. Always include a penalty clause for delays exceeding 14 days in your Purchase Order (PO) to ensure the supplier prioritizes your production slot.

What are the transaction security tips for international drone component sourcing?

Always conduct transactions through verified B2B platforms and avoid direct wire transfers to private accounts. Ensure the Incoterms (e.g., DAP or CIF) are clearly defined in the contract. For first-time large orders, consider hiring a third-party inspection agency (like SGS or Intertek) to perform a pre-shipment inspection at the supplier's warehouse in China.
